Comprehending Robot Floor Cleaners
Robot floor cleaners, likewise understood as robotic vacuums, are compact devices created to autonomously clean floorings. They use a selection of sensors and advanced algorithms to navigate through living areas, avoiding obstacles and ensuring that they cover the required location. These intelligent devices can be managed through smartphones, and some are geared up with voice-activated abilities, making them a modern option for home cleaning.
Secret Features of Robot Floor Cleaners
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Navigation System | The majority of robot cleaners utilize advanced mapping innovations such as LID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or cam vision to navigate areas. |
| Smart Connectivity | Numerous models are Wi-Fi made it possible for, enabling for app control and integration with clever home gadgets. |
| Cleaning Modes | A lot of models come with several cleaning modes, consisting of automobile, spot, and edge cleansing, tailored for various cleaning requirements. |
| Battery Life | Battery endurance differs, typically between 60 to 150 minutes, depending upon the model and cleaning mode used. |
| Filter Technology | High-efficiency particle air (HEPA) filters are common, trapping dust and irritants effectively. |
| Size and Design | Compact and low-profile styles enable robot cleaners to fit under furnishings quickly. |

Kinds Of Robot Floor Cleaners
Robot floor cleaners differ in features and performance. Here are a few of the most common types: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Requirement Vacuum | Fundamental designs that focus mainly on vacuuming carpets and hard floorings. |
| Wet and Dry Cleaners | Equipped with mopping performance, these models can both vacuum and mop floors. |
| Family Pet Hair Focused | Particularly developed with features to deal with pet hair, such as more powerful suction and specialized brushes. |
| Smart Home Compatible | These models integrate with clever home systems, enabling voice control by means of virtual ass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ant. |
Key Considerations When Choosing a Robot Floor Cleaner
When picking a robot floor cleaner, it's necessary to consider numerous factors to guarantee it meets your cleansing needs. Here are some crucial points to evaluate:
- Floor Types: Assess the types of floor covering in your house (carpet, wood, tiles) and choose a design that finest accommodates those requirements.
- Size of the Area: Consider the size of your home. Larger homes might need models with longer battery life and a more effective navigation system.
- Budget: Robot flooring cleaners vary considerably in rate. It's crucial to determine your budget and focus on features.
- Upkeep: Some models need more maintenance than others. Examine the ease of litter disposal, brush cleaning, and filter replacement.
- Noise Level: If sound is a concern, search for designs known for quieter operations, specifically in homes with pets or little kids.
FAQ Section
1. How typically should I run my robot floor cleaner?
Generally, running it 2-3 times weekly is recommended, but this can depend upon your home's traffic and animal presence.
2. Can robot flooring cleaners handle pet hair?
Yes, lots of designs are specifically designed for pet hair and function stronger suction and specialized brushes to gather hair efficiently.
3. How do I maintain my robot floor cleaner?
Routine upkeep includes clearing the dustbin, cleaning up brushes, and replacing filters as needed per the maker's instructions.
4. Are robot flooring cleaners reliable on carpets?
Yes, numerous modern-day robot vacuums are developed to handle both carpets and tough floors efficiently, however check specs to make sure viability for your carpet type.
5. Can I control my robot floor cleaner from another location?
The majority of existing models offer push-button control through a mobile app, or integration with wise home gadgets for added benefit.
